Is Pain In Abdomen Normal In A Pregnant Women?

I am 26 years ols, 5'3 and 23 weeks pregnant. I am experiencing pain in my abdomen. At first it would just happen when i had to urinate, and i felt relief after doing so, but now it has been happening while doing regular activities such as bending and squatting. It also really hurts when I sneeze. I have a doctors appointment in two days but didnt know if I should wait.

OBGYN 's  Response
There s a possibility of urinary infection or even a calculi causing a ureteric colic as it is typically associated with urination try drinking lot of water n some urine alkalinizer most of the time it helps
